Abstract

A method and apparatus are disclosed for recycling items of media. The apparatus includes at least a pair of co-operable feed belt members that receive a depositable item of media at a first location and locate the depositable item at a stack position in a storage container. The apparatus also includes at least a pair of co-operable dispense belt members that selectively pivot between an operational and non-operational position. In the operational position, at least one of the dispense belt members is disposed to remove an item from the stack position and provide the removed item to the feed belt members. The feed belt members are arranged to locate an item of media received from the dispense belt members at said first location.

Claims (30)

1. Apparatus for recycling items of media, comprising:

at least a pair of co-operable feed belt members that receive a depositable item of media at a first location and locate the depositable item at a stack position in a storage container; and

at least a pair of co-operable dispense belt members that selectively pivot between an operational and non-operational position; wherein

in the operational position, at least one of the dispense belt members is disposed to remove an item from the stack position and provide the removed item to the feed belt members, said feed belt members being arranged to locate an item of media received from the dispense belt members at said first location.

2.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ising:

at least one selectively rotatable wheel element comprising a plurality of flapper members that urge an item of media against a one of the feed belt members in a respective pair as the wheel element rotates.

3.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ising:

at least one selectively rotatable wheel element that pivots with the dispense belt members and comprises a plurality of flapper members that urge an item of media removed from the stack position between the dispense belt members in a respective pair.

4.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ising:

at least one dispense belt member in each pair of dispense belt members, when in the operational position, is urged towards a pusher plate element of the storage container and is located nearer to a stack of remaining items of media in the storage container than a location of a feed belt member.

5. An Automated Teller Machine (ATM) or Teller Cash Recycler (TCR) comprising the ap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ein each item of media is a currency note.

6.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ising:

at least a one feed belt member in each pair of feed belt members has a surface comprising a low co-efficient of friction.

7. The apparatus as claimed in claim 6 , further comprising:

a portion of said at least a one feed belt member extends below a surface of a floor of the storage container.

8. The apparatus as claimed in claim 6 , further comprising:

at least a one dispense belt member in each pair of dispense belt members has a surface comprising a co-efficient of friction greater than the low co-efficient of friction.

9. The apparatus as claimed in claim 6 , further comprising:

a remainder one dispense belt member is a retard belt member comprising a co-efficient of friction less than said at least one dispense belt member and that moves in an opposite direction to the feed belt member in said operational position.

10. A method of recycling items of media, comprising the steps of:

storing an item of media in a storage container by receiving a depositable item of media at a first location and locating the depositable item in a stack position in the container via at least a pair of co-operable feed belt members; and

dispensing an item of media from the storage container by selectively pivoting at least a pair of co-operable dispense belt members into an operational position and, via at least one of the dispense belt members, removing the item from the stack position and providing the item at the first location via the feed belt members.

11. The method as claimed in claim 10 , further comprising the steps of:

locating at least one item of media in the stack position by rotating an endless belt comprising a one of said pair of feed belt members and allowing the endless belt member to slip against a contact surface of an item of media subsequent to the item of media being located at the stack position.

12. The method as claimed in claim 10 , further comprising the steps of:

urging remaining items of media stored in a stacked arrangement in the storage container towards the stack position via a biased pusher plate element.

13. The method as claimed in claim 10 , further comprising the steps of:

lifting at least one item of media from the stack position to thereby remove the item from the stack position, said lifting step comprising urging a portion of a rotating endless belt comprising the at least one dispense belt member against a contact surface of an item of media at the stack position, whereby friction moves said an item of media with the rotating endless belt.

14. The method as claimed in claim 13 , further comprising the steps of:

separating items of media lifted from the stack position by rotating a further endless belt member comprising a remaining one dispense belt member moving in an opposite direction with respect to a rotation direction of said at least one dispense belt member.
